I have the previous iteration which is Honor 5x. I think it was a great value (I bought for US$120 on sale last summer). Comparing Honor 6x vs. 5x:
RAM 3Gb vs. 2Gb (Good);
Storage 32Gb vs. 16Gb (Good);
Dual Sim hybrid slot (I believe) where you can either use 2 SIM cards, or 1 SIM card and 1 Micro-SD vs. 3 slots on Honor 5x (Terrible)
With 1 SIM active on LTE/ 4G/ 3G, Second SIM will only support 2G (which for now means Rogers-only networks in Canada, and none in the US?) - same as Honor 5x, but come on, 2nd SIM should at minimum support 3G! (Meh)

A whole lot of 1-star ratings on Amazon.
In short: the price is fine, but as dual-sim it is pretty much useless, unless you use Speakout or some such on the 2nd SIM, and you don't need the extra storage that a Micro-sd card would provide. Going by Amazon comments, the quality may have gone down since they made Honor 5x

Edit: to clarify, my understanding is 2G is on its way to extinction, and has already been killed off in the US. I have seen some claims that Rogers will turn their 2G off in Jan 2018, but I'm not 100% sure...
